**Vendor note: Inkmill markdown pipeline**

Rendering for Parchway docs is outsourced to Inkmill under an annual contract, renewing each March. They handle sanitization and PDF export; we own the upload queue. SLA: 4-hour response on rendering failures. Escalate only after two failed retries. Their support desk is reachable at the address below.

billing contact of hahaf-baguf = zorael.tammir.jorius@sivrelhq.internal

Plugin artifacts signed on agent-9 appeared older than their inputs, so Hobberlane's incremental cache rejected them. Plugin authors affected: any build using timestamp-based staleness checks between 13:50 and 14:10. Mitigation: agents repointed to the Greywick time source; cache invalidated cluster-wide. Plugin authors should rebuild against the restored fleet and verify against the reference trace recorded below.

session token of tajef-bageg = htk21_5d90d574934f3ccae6437

### Ticket: Drift on cold-storage archiver config

Heads up, future maintainers — the Gullwharf archiver's live config has drifted from what's in source control again. Someone bumped the tiering threshold by hand during the Fenmoor incident and never backported it, so re-provisioned nodes quietly archive buckets on the old schedule. Please treat the repo as the source of truth and reconcile the live boxes against it. For the record, the values currently running in production are captured below.

service settings:
PRAIX_LOG_LEVEL=error
PRAIX_METRICS_HOST=metrics.praix.qorvelcorp.corp
PRAIX_POOL_SIZE=16